Freddie Freeman of the Los Angeles Dodgers had a notable performance on August 10, 2025, despite his team's loss to the Toronto Blue Jays. This recap summarizes his contributions and recent form.
Freddie Freeman's performance on August 10, 2025, showcased his value to the Los Angeles Dodgers, even in a losing effort. In the game against the Blue Jays, Freeman demonstrated his ability to impact the game in multiple ways, starting with a solo home run in the first inning, giving the Dodgers an early lead.
His plate discipline was also on display, as he drew two walks, including two bases-loaded walks that resulted in RBIs. Despite the Dodgers ultimately falling short, Freeman's contributions highlight his consistent offensive production throughout the season.
Over his last 12 games, Freeman has been on a hot streak, hitting .400 with four home runs and 14 RBIs. This recent surge has further solidified his reputation as one of the premier hitters in baseball. His season slash line of .305/.378/.491 reflects his ability to hit for average, get on base, and provide power. However, his strikeout rate of 22.6 percent is the highest it has been since 2016, indicating a potential area for improvement.
